"Every violation of truth is not only a sort of suicide in the liar, but is a stab at the health of human society."
-Ralph Waldo Emerson, Essays: Second Series
In Essays: Second Series (1844) by Ralph Waldo Emerson, the author brought together a series of writings that laid out many of the fundamental concepts of the philosophical system that has come to be known as Transcendentalism. This book contains, "The Poet," "Experience," "Character," "Manners," "Gifts, "Nature," "Politics," "Nominalist and Realist," and "New England Reformers."
